Mesothelioma Claim - How to File a Mesothelioma Claim

A mesothelioma claim will compensate for financial losses caused by asbestos exposure. Patients and their families require funds to pay for the cost of treatment and replace income loss.

Many asbestos companies declared bankruptcy and created trust funds to compensate victims. An experienced mesothelioma lawyer will determine whether you qualify to make a mesothelioma trust fund claim.

Compensation

Compensation for mesothelioma may help patients and their families cover medical expenses as well as caregiving costs and other expenses. Compensation is awarded by a combination asbestos trust funds, trial verdicts, and settlements. The amount of mesothelioma compensation is determined by the particular circumstances of each case.

Anyone diagnosed with mesothelioma should seek compensation from the companies responsible for their exposure. A mesothelioma lawyer will handle all aspects of the claim, allowing victims to concentrate on their treatment and recovery. Asbestos attorneys have filed thousands of mesothelioma claims that were successful, resulting billions in compensation to the families of victims.

Mesothelioma lawyers can also assist patients with filing an workers' compensation or disability insurance claim to help with the expense of treatment. The amount of compensation awarded for these types is usually much less than what is paid in a mesothelioma lawsuit or lawsuit.

The best way to ensure mesothelioma victims receive the full amount of compensation they deserve is to make a claim against the negligent parties responsible for their asbestos exposure. However, filing a mesothelioma law suit can be difficult and time-consuming. A mesothelioma attorney can help victims and family members to file a suit in the most efficient manner possible.

Many mesothelioma patients were exposed to asbestos while working or during military service. Asbestos manufacturers were aware that asbestos could cause cancer but they did not recognize mesothelioma. In the end, some patients experienced symptoms that lasted for up to 50 years after their first exposure.

Mesothelioma can be a costly illness to treat, and sufferers may struggle to meet their financial obligations. The compensation from mesothelioma lawsuits and trust funds can help them overcome these obstacles and take back control of their lives.

Asbestos victims may also be eligible for benefits from the government, such as VA benefits and Social Security Disability. But, it is crucial to consult a professional mesothelioma lawyer before applying for these types of programs. A lawyer who is experienced can guide veterans and their family members through the application process, ensuring that all documents are submitted in a timely manner.

Treatment grants

The mesothelioma financial burden is so immense that many sufferers are unable to pay for treatment. Patients may be required to pay for travel costs to get treatment or undergo medical tests and surgeries which are not covered by insurance. Mesothelioma lawyers help patients receive compensation awards to cover future and past medical expenses.

Asbestos patients can also receive treatment grants to assist with the cost of prescription medications and other treatments. These grants are available through mesothelioma experts, and utilized for a range of treatments, including chemotherapy and surgical procedures. In addition, patients can qualify for disability payments from the Social Security Administration. To determine if a patient is eligible to receive SSDI benefits they must meet certain criteria. These include having mesothelioma that is malignant in the mediastinum or pleura, and being unable to work in an ordinary job because of the disease.

Travel resources and support groups for mesothelioma patients may provide assistance to patients needing travel to receive treatment. They can help with flights, lodging and other costs. Many organizations also assist in to find temporary accommodation for mesothelioma patients as well as their families. For instance, the Fisher House Foundation has at least one facility located on property of major medical military hospitals and veterans clinics.

Financial issues can adversely affect the quality of life of mesothelioma patients. This is because a lack of funds can cause stress, which can impact the body's ability to fight off disease and recover from surgery or other treatments. Researchers have found that patients who are stressed are more difficult in recovering after their diagnosis and respond less well to treatments that fight cancer.

A personal injury lawyer will collect information on a mesothelioma victim's background to identify the asbestos companies that are responsible for their exposure. They will look into the victim's entire working history, including the locations to which asbestos was exposed as well as the products they used. They will also search for any other legal avenues to compensation, like asbestos trust funds that were established by asbestos producers when they faced extreme litigation.

Insurance

Mesothelioma patients may be eligible for various types of insurance coverage to aid in the cost of treatment. These benefits can give peace of mind to families going through a difficult time. People with mesothelioma should be advised to review their options, and talk with a mesothelioma attorney to get further guidance.

In addition to private insurance, mesothelioma patients could be eligible for government-run programs like Medicare and Medicaid. These insurance plans are designed to aid people who are older and those with low household incomes.

Patients are eligible for these programs when they are diagnosed with mesothelioma and are unable to work due to their illness. They can utilize these funds to pay for treatment and other expenses. In certain instances, victims of mesothelioma may also be eligible for compensation through a wrongful-death claim against the company which exposed them to asbestos.

Another type of insurance mesothelioma patients can utilize is group health insurance. It is a type of insurance that is typically provided by employers to their employees. These policies are different from private individual health insurance in that they are negotiated for the all-encompassing company, not for each employee individually. This means that mesothelioma victims will not be denied or charged a higher price.

Workers insurance benefits are available to mesothelioma patients able to work. This is a type of insurance that provides compensation for medical and legal expenses. It also covers the loss of wages caused by illness. These payments cannot be used for treatment that is not covered by the insurance of the worker.

Asbestos-related victims who are not able to work may be eligible for disability benefits through the Social Security Administration. These benefits can be used to replace lost income and pay for essential expenses such as transportation and treatment costs. In certain cases mesothelioma lawyers are able to help clients obtain these benefits. This can save victims and their families considerable time and money. In addition, these attorneys can help victims file the correct paperwork to support their claims.

Veterans' benefits

Many veterans who have been diagnosed with mesothelioma or any other asbestos-related illnesses may be qualified for compensation. Compensation may include monthly disability payments as along with medical treatment and travel costs to mesothelioma-treatment centers. A mesothelioma lawyer will help veterans choose the most appropriate VA claim and compensation options for their circumstances. The kind of cancer a veteran is suffering from, as well as their income level may affect eligibility for benefits.

The VA provides a range of programs for veterans with mesothelioma and other asbestos-related diseases. These include travel benefits, pensions and disability compensation. Disability compensation is a tax-free monthly payment that is determined by the severity of a veterans mesothelioma diagnosis as well as their related disabilities due to service. Veterans diagnosed with mesothelioma who have a 100% disability rating and higher typically receive the highest monthly payment.

Veterans suffering from mesothelioma with disabilities that are connected to their service are eligible for free treatment at the West Los Angeles VA Medical Center. The VA also offers housing and transportation from and to the mesothelioma specialist. Some veterans have utilized these free mesothelioma treatments and have increased their lives and quality of life.

Certain veterans are also eligible for a homebound benefit, or Aid and Attendance (A&A). This benefit can help a veteran get a caregiver when they require assistance with activities of daily living, such as bathing eating, dressing and bathing. Some veterans suffer from bedriddenness due to an undiagnosed condition that is not diagnosed until later. This benefit can cover the cost of a home health aide or nursing care.
